@[isaacgesser:1933] I agree, I would add I think it's with a man, it's just the way I hear it, and I think he is married, I can't think of a better reason to put a wall up and not pursue this passion....but he's not allowed, he's uninvited an unfortunate slight. He's off limits, hence married, he's uninvited, she doesn't want to have an affair, an unfortunate slight, she has a wall up but regrettably so. I agree with how her resolve weakens as the tempo gets stronger and also the lyrics suggest this. I believe at the end, when she says "I don't think you unworthy, I just need a moment to deliberate" the music gets very aggressive and climaxes, and in my opinion, she gives in finally to her passions. I think the music goes quiet because its the calm before the storm, her choice that will bring a storm of passion and craziness. But I also see your interpretation as well, that she is released. Again, the uncharted territory, I see a man who is married and in a loveless marriage and wants the woman in the song, and he cant have her....yet. You wrote in the beginning "From what I see in this song this is a woman trying to tease her love interest into higher desire." I too think she is teasing him into higher desire I also agree with the classic subconscious pushing him away to see if he'll come back, and back hotter and wanting her more. I think when she says "like any hot blooded woman, I have simply wanted an object to crave" I don't see that necessarily as a casual encounter, a craving can be satisfied quickly, but usually if we crave something, we crave it over and over again and continue to need the craving satisfied. This just my two cents piggy backing off of your interpretation. |
